Ruby May Eagland 1907 - 1966

Ruby May Eagland of Mansfield, Mansfield Shire County, VIC Australia was born on March 25, 1907 in Drouin, Baw Baw Shire County to Alice Maud (Knight) Eagland and Edwin Henry Eagland. She had siblings Alice Emma Eagland, Alma Jane Eagland, Lorna Violet Eagland, and Winifred Maud Eagland. Ruby Eagland died at age 58 years old on March 13, 1966 in Mansfield, Mansfield Shire County.

In 1907, in the year that Ruby May Eagland was born, the Monongah coal mining disaster occurred on December 6th, happening at the Fairmont Coal Company’s No. 6 and No. 8 mines.. Over 361 miners were killed. Because there was no breathing apparatus at the time to help rescuers, recovery efforts were greatly hampered. It is considered the worst mining disaster in American history and led to government oversight in mining practices.

In 1929, when she was 22 years old, the St. Valentine's Day Massacre happened on February 14th. In Chicago, seven men from the North Side Irish gang were gunned down by Al Capone's South Side Italian gang at the garage at 2122 North Clark Street. Al Capone was making a successful move to take over Chicago's organized crime. But the St. Valentine's Day massacre also resulted in a public outcry against all gangsters.
